|
|
@@ -0,0 +1,116 @@
|
|
|
+package com.ruoyi.device.mqtt.vo;
|
|
|
+
|
|
|
+import java.util.Date;
|
|
|
+import java.util.Set;
|
|
|
+
|
|
|
+/**
|
|
|
+ * 调试宝设备 MQTT 登录在线信息(以 deviceSn 为 key,因为 deviceSn 是必填的)
|
|
|
+ * 后续使用 deviceSn 获取设备信息/用户信息
|
|
|
+ *
|
|
|
+ * @author lwm
|
|
|
+ */
|
|
|
+public class DeviceOnlineInfo
|
|
|
+{
|
|
|
+ /** 用户信息部分 */
|
|
|
+ private Long userId;
|
|
|
+ private String userName;
|
|
|
+ private String phoneNumber;
|
|
|
+ private String nickName;
|
|
|
+ private String roleName;
|
|
|
+ private Set<String> permissions;
|
|
|
+
|
|
|
+ /** 设备信息部分 */
|
|
|
+ private Long deviceId;
|
|
|
+ private Long deviceSn;
|
|
|
+ private String deviceType;
|
|
|
+ private String imei;
|
|
|
+ private Date bindTime;
|
|
|
+
|
|
|
+ public Long getUserId() {
|
|
|
+ return userId;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setUserId(Long userId) {
|
|
|
+ this.userId = userId;
|
|
|
+ }
|
|
|
+
|
|
|
+ public String getUserName() {
|
|
|
+ return userName;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setUserName(String userName) {
|
|
|
+ this.userName = userName;
|
|
|
+ }
|
|
|
+
|
|
|
+ public String getPhoneNumber() {
|
|
|
+ return phoneNumber;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setPhoneNumber(String phoneNumber) {
|
|
|
+ this.phoneNumber = phoneNumber;
|
|
|
+ }
|
|
|
+
|
|
|
+ public String getNickName() {
|
|
|
+ return nickName;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setNickName(String nickName) {
|
|
|
+ this.nickName = nickName;
|
|
|
+ }
|
|
|
+
|
|
|
+ public String getRoleName() {
|
|
|
+ return roleName;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setRoleName(String roleName) {
|
|
|
+ this.roleName = roleName;
|
|
|
+ }
|
|
|
+
|
|
|
+ public Set<String> getPermissions() {
|
|
|
+ return permissions;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setPermissions(Set<String> permissions) {
|
|
|
+ this.permissions = permissions;
|
|
|
+ }
|
|
|
+
|
|
|
+ public Long getDeviceId() {
|
|
|
+ return deviceId;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setDeviceId(Long deviceId) {
|
|
|
+ this.deviceId = deviceId;
|
|
|
+ }
|
|
|
+
|
|
|
+ public Long getDeviceSn() {
|
|
|
+ return deviceSn;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setDeviceSn(Long deviceSn) {
|
|
|
+ this.deviceSn = deviceSn;
|
|
|
+ }
|
|
|
+
|
|
|
+ public String getDeviceType() {
|
|
|
+ return deviceType;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setDeviceType(String deviceType) {
|
|
|
+ this.deviceType = deviceType;
|
|
|
+ }
|
|
|
+
|
|
|
+ public String getImei() {
|
|
|
+ return imei;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setImei(String imei) {
|
|
|
+ this.imei = imei;
|
|
|
+ }
|
|
|
+
|
|
|
+ public Date getBindTime() {
|
|
|
+ return bindTime;
|
|
|
+ }
|
|
|
+
|
|
|
+ public void setBindTime(Date bindTime) {
|
|
|
+ this.bindTime = bindTime;
|
|
|
+ }
|
|
|
+}
|